Types of Joint Degrees

Types of Joint Degrees thumbnail
Many students who want to go into health care as a career are opting for joint degrees.

Joint degrees are obtained by individuals who want to specialize in two or more areas. Joint degrees are becoming available in more universities and colleges because they are recognizing the need for students to have multiple areas of expertise. There is an endless amount of joint degrees to choose from, but they may require the permission of a university dean. Having a joint degree can increase your chances of reaching your professional dreams, especially in a job market that has become so competitive.

  1. Health

    • Joint degrees in the health industry are becoming popular because students see much more opportunity in the field. For example, students studying nursing have the option in many schools to work toward a joint degree, such as combining public health and education. Students are able to combine their nursing degrees with another degree to widen their career opportunities. Many who pursue joint degrees in nursing and other areas may go on to work in health administration or work for health departments on a state or federal level, or they may choose to teach about health.

    Business

    • It is not uncommon for business students to work toward joint degrees. Students learn the basics of business, marketing, developing a product and managing a business, but they also want to combine their business knowledge with their passion. A joint degree allows them to do this. Students may take courses in engineering, health care, education, accounting or other subjects that may help them focus on a specialty when they enter the job market.

    Law

    • Law students commonly work toward joint degrees to give them more of a background and expertise in the area of law where they want to work. Lawyers supplement their law studies with such subjects as psychology or business. Lawyers who want to work in certain industries, such as accounting, insurance, engineering or law enforcement, will obtain joint degrees in subjects that contain those components.

    Education

    • An education joint degree is useful for those who want to combine their skills and training as educators with training in specific topics and subjects. Education degrees can be combined with a fine arts degree or sociology or anthropology degrees for those who want to work in art galleries or museums. Educators can take on a joint degree in a language, science or other subject if they want to become an English teacher or science teacher. In fact, most education degrees will incorporate a joint degree into their program to assist students in long-term career goals.
